Japanese Households' Stock Holdings Surpass Insurance and Pensions for First Time

Revised BoJ data show Japanese household stock and fund investments reached ¥590 trillion in March 2026, exceeding insurance and pension assets (¥579 trillion) for the first time since 2005. The gap widened in preliminary June data, signaling a structural shift in household asset allocation toward risk assets. This reflects the impact of the NISA program and equity market gains, with implications for Japanese financial markets and household balance sheets.
